What is Ectoin?
Ectoin is a natural substance. It was first discovered in extremophilic microorganisms, particularly halophilic bacteria that thrive in harsh environments such as high - salt lakes like Wadi EI Natrun. These bacteria produce Ectoin as a protective mechanism. In conditions where the temperature can soar to 65°C during the day and drop below 0°C at night, with air humidity around 5% and salt concentrations over 30%, Ectoin helps the bacteria maintain cell integrity and functionality. As explained in research on extremophiles, Ectoin plays a crucial role in osmoregulation, allowing the cells to adapt to extreme osmotic pressures.
Chemical Structure and Properties
The unique chemical structure of Ectoin endows it with extraordinary properties. It is a small, water - soluble molecule, which enables it to penetrate the skin's epidermis rapidly. Each Ectoin molecule has the ability to bind with 4 - 5 water molecules, forming a hydration shell. This property is fundamental to its functionality in cosmetic applications. Advantages of Ectoin in Cosmetics
- Superior Moisturizing Ability
Ectoin is a powerhouse when it comes to moisturization. By binding water molecules, it significantly enhances the skin’s moisture - holding capacity. It helps to maintain the skin’s natural moisture barrier, reducing transepidermal water loss. - Exceptional Skin Protection
In the face of environmental stressors like UV radiation, pollution, and extreme temperatures, Ectoin acts as a shield for the skin. It can protect the skin cells from oxidative stress, which is a major contributor to skin aging. UV rays can cause damage to the skin's DNA, leading to the formation of free radicals. - Anti - inflammatory Effects
For those with sensitive or inflamed skin, Ectoin offers a ray of hope. It has anti - inflammatory properties that can soothe irritated skin. Inflammatory skin conditions such as acne, rosacea, and contact dermatitis can cause redness, swelling, and discomfort. Applications of Ectoin in the Cosmetic Field
- skincare Products
In moisturizers, serums, and creams, Ectoin is becoming an increasingly popular ingredient. It can be found in products targeting various skin concerns, from anti - aging to hydration. For example, some high - end anti - aging serums combine Ectoin with other powerful ingredients like Retinol and hyaluronic acid. The Ectoin helps to protect the skin from the potential irritation caused by retinol, while also enhancing the overall moisturizing effect of the product. - Suncare Products
Given its ability to protect against UV - induced damage, Ectoin is a natural fit for suncare products. Sunscreens with Ectoin not only provide protection against the sun's harmful rays but also offer additional skin - protecting and soothing benefits. Some Ectoin - based sunscreens are designed to be lightweight and non - greasy, making them suitable for daily use. - Haircare Products
Ectoin's benefits extend to haircare as well. It can be used in shampoos, conditioners, and hair masks. In haircare products, Ectoin helps to moisturize the hair shafts, reducing frizz and breakage. It also protects the hair from environmental damage, such as pollution and heat styling.
